Output 348335ff65d0a5c0d9a5fedc2c99b74afbb20c18511fd9bec353e29050c24fa4:1

value
19431674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b4f24294636a240f95ca115da5f86186f75e21c OP_EQUAL
address
3EPcf3DLT6ao86odMFi6stpJcsEA1biXCX
transaction
348335ff65d0a5c0d9a5fedc2c99b74afbb20c18511fd9bec353e29050c24fa4
spent
true